Water Damage Mitigation: Stop the Clock First
Water Damage Mitigation is the instant reaction after a leakage, flooding, pipeline break, appliance failure, or roof covering intrusion. The objective is to avoid additional damage. That consists of swelling and buckling of timber, delamination of cupboards, rusting of fasteners, microbial development, and structural weakening.
A proper mitigation plan generally adheres to a foreseeable series.
1) Safety and resource control
Water gets shut down if required, electric threats are addressed, and the source of wetness is quit. If water is originating from sewage or outside flooding, the approach modifications because contamination risk changes the cleaning standard.
2) Inspection and moisture mapping
Professionals utilize moisture meters, thermal imaging, and hygrometers to recognize what is wet and exactly how far it took a trip. The wet place you see is hardly ever the full footprint. Water can wick up drywall, travel along framing, and resolve under floor covering.
3) Extraction and removal of unsalvageable materials
Standing water is removed, saturated materials that can not be dried out securely are eliminated, and the work is supported for drying. The decision to get rid of or dry is not uncertainty. It is based on the classification of water, dwell time, and the material type.
4) Drying and dehumidification
Air moving companies and dehumidifiers are placed to create regulated airflow and remove dampness from the air so materials can launch trapped water. This step is kept an eye on daily, not set and forgotten.
5) Cleaning and antimicrobial application where suitable
If the event entailed contamination or there is a high danger of microbial activity, cleansing and treatment might be put on affected surfaces. This is additionally where odor control may begin if the water event has been sitting.
6) Verification and documents
Drying targets must be confirmed with wetness analyses and videotaped. Paperwork issues for insurance coverage, and it matters for the property owner so there is proof the framework was dried out correctly prior to reconstructing starts.
The biggest error after a water occasion is beginning repairs prior to the structure is in fact dry. New floor covering, walls, and paint can catch dampness and set the stage for future mold development.
Mold Remediation: Remove the Problem, Not Just the Stain
Mold Remediation is the process of identifying mold and mildew contamination, having it, eliminating affected materials when required, cleaning up continuing to be surfaces, and dealing with the dampness problems that permitted it to expand.
Mold and mildew is usually discovered after a sluggish leakage, HVAC condensation, bad air flow, or a previous water occasion that was not dried fully. It can likewise turn up behind cupboards, under sinks, around windows, and in attic rooms with bad airflow.
Expert remediation generally consists of these components.
Analysis and extent
A qualified supplier defines the damaged area, the likely dampness source, and the products entailed. Sometimes testing is made use of, but it is not always called for to begin remediation. What matters is a clear scope and a strategy to deal with the dampness vehicle driver.
Containment and adverse air
Containment prevents cross-contamination. Plastic bed linen, zipper doors, and unfavorable air makers with HEPA filtering are used so spores and dirt remain inside the job area and exhaust is filtered correctly.
Managed demolition when needed
Porous products that are greatly polluted typically get eliminated, drywall, insulation, carpeting cushioning, ceiling ceramic tiles, and some types of particle board. Attempting to "deal with" or "seal" heavily read here impacted permeable product is a typical shortcut that falls short later on.
HEPA vacuuming and cleaning
Hard surface areas and staying framing are cleansed making use of techniques that match the situation. HEPA vacuuming, wet cleaning, and approved cleansing representatives are used to get rid of cleared up particulate and surface development.
Drying and dampness modification
No remediation is full up until the moisture concern is remedied. That might suggest taking care of plumbing, boosting restroom ventilation, remedying grading outside, sealing a roof covering penetration, or readjusting HVAC moisture control.
Post-work verification
A high quality job finishes with confirmation that the location is clean and completely dry, and that control did not spread contamination. Some tasks include clearance screening performed by an independent event, especially in higher-risk setups.
A strong general rule is easy. If a person provides "mold and mildew removal" without control, without HEPA filtration, and without a clear wetness solution, they are typically marketing a cosmetic wipe-down, not removal.
Fire Disaster Restoration: Smoke, Soot, and Water All at Once
Fire Disaster Restoration is frequently misconstrued because lots of people think the damage is restricted to the scorched room. Actually, smoke and residue migrate, and the water made use of to extinguish the fire produces a 2nd disaster inside the exact same framework. Even little fires can trigger prevalent odor, rust, and discoloration, especially if HVAC returns pulled smoke via the system.
A complete fire remediation work usually covers four damages groups.
1) Structural and material damage
Shed framework, drywall, insulation, flooring, and roofing might require elimination and rebuilding. Structural security has to be confirmed before comprehensive job starts.
2) Soot and smoke deposit
Soot is not just filthy dirt. It can be acidic, oily, and exceptionally great, and it can settle in places you will not observe till smells return. Various fires create different residues. A kitchen area oil fire acts in different ways than an electric fire, and both vary from a wildfire smoke intrusion. Cleaning methods need to match the kind of deposit.
3) Odor control
Smell elimination has to do with getting rid of the resource, not concealing it. This generally consists of detailed cleaning of surfaces, soft goods, and hidden spaces, and then targeted deodorization methods once cleaning is complete.
4) Water damage from suppression efforts
Fire jobs often include Water Damage Mitigation because suppression water fills structure products and elevates moisture. That wetness can cause mold and mildew if not dried quickly.
Fire restoration also involves mindful handling of HVAC systems. Air ducts, coils, and air trainers can hold residue and odor. If smoke traveled through the system, the HVAC cleaning strategy need to be attended to early so the issue does not get redistributed after the structure resumes.
The Overlap Between Water Damage, Mold, and Fire
These solutions typically stack together.
A pipeline break brings about Water Damage Mitigation, and if drying out is delayed or incomplete, it can bring about Mold Remediation.
A fire brings about Fire Disaster Restoration, and commonly includes Water Damage Mitigation from firefighting efforts.
A tiny cooking area fire can still need comprehensive cleansing and smell control if smoke moved into attic rooms, wall surface tooth cavities, or HVAC.
The best reconstruction groups deal with the full chain, reduction, remediation, cleanup, and repair, or they collaborate closely so handoffs do not develop spaces.
What "Professional" Looks Like and What to Avoid
Restoration is a room where shortcuts are common, primarily since the majority of people don't see what was done behind wall surfaces or under floors. Below are signals that normally indicate strong work.
Created range with clear steps and what is consisted of
Moisture analyses and drying logs for water losses
Control and HEPA filtration for mold and mildew jobs
Correct PPE and risk-free job methods
Image paperwork before, throughout, and after
A plan that consists of fixing the resource of moisture or damage
Clear interaction on what can be saved versus what have to be eliminated
Usual red flags.
Assures of instant outcomes without inspection
" Fogging just" supplied as the primary mold and mildew service
Fixings starting prior to drying out is verified
No control in a mold task
Obscure pricing without any recorded scope
Stress tactics around insurance coverage cases
If the work is being dealt with under an insurance policy claim, paperwork issues. Drying logs, pictures, and detailed scopes assist the case move faster and minimize disagreements.
Timeline Expectations
Every project is different, yet basic ranges assist establish assumptions.
Water Damage Mitigation frequently takes 3 to 7 days for drying when tools is set, longer if materials are thick or the framework has multiple layers and cavities.
Mold Remediation can be 1 to 5 days for normal household work, longer for widespread contamination, multi-room containment, or complicated architectural elimination.
Fire Disaster Restoration varies the most. Minor smoke clean-up may take a couple of days, while complete restore projects can take weeks or months depending on structural damage, permitting, and product schedule.
The trick is that drying out and cleansing are not the end of the job. Rebuild, painting, flooring, and finish work are separate phases, and they ought to begin just when the framework is verified prepared.
Avoidance After Restoration
As soon as the building is restored, the best time to prevent a repeat event is right away.
For water, focus on shutoff valves, appliance supply lines, hot water heater age, roof upkeep, and water drainage around the structure.
For mold and mildew, concentrate on moisture control, shower room air flow, attic room air flow, and repairing any type of repeating condensation points like sweating ducts.
For fire, focus on electric safety and security, cooking area security methods, dryer vent cleaning, and smoke alarm upkeep. If wildfire smoke is a regional danger, enhance filtration and sealing where sensible.
